That which had been bought for a dollar worth sixty cents, must be paid for with a dollar worth eighty, ninety, or a hundred cents, according to the date on which the contract matured.
Said by
John Sherman
Ohio

Editor's note · Context

Sherman illustrates the challenges of fulfilling contracts when currency values fluctuate.
